Transaction 74c12ba41cc7333baa4d46477caf36fa65c95130f986bd0d93e6abb249a5e893
1 Input
1 Output
-
74c12ba41cc7333baa4d46477caf36fa65c95130f986bd0d93e6abb249a5e893:0
- value
- 24031409
- script pubkey
- OP_0 OP_PUSHBYTES_20 70a49bb54696cafd1171f89c15df5e59f534dfd1
- address
- bc1qwzjfhd2xjm906yt3lzwpth67t86nfh73rzqrfj